Understanding Prescription and Over-the-Counter Medications

Navigating the complex world of medications can be difficult. It's important to comprehend the differences between prescription and over-the-counter (OTC) treatments. Prescription drugs require a doctor's authorization due to their likely for significant side effects or combinations with other treatments. OTC treatments, on the other hand, are available without a authorization and are generally considered harmless for at-home treatment of frequent ailments.

It's always best to consult a healthcare professional before starting any new medication, regardless of whether it is prescription or OTC. They can guide on the suitable amount, potential side effects, and combinations with other medications you may be taking.

Active Pharmaceutical Ingredients: A Crucial Component in Drug Development

Active pharmaceutical ingredients key drug substances are the fundamental building blocks of any medication. They are the chemical compounds responsible for producing a therapeutic effect in the body. During the arduous process of drug development, APIs undergo rigorous testing and evaluation to ensure their safety, efficacy, and durability . The selection of an appropriate API is paramount, as it directly influences the nature of the final drug product.

From initial screening to clinical trials and production , APIs play a central role in every stage of drug development.

Researchers invest significant resources in the exploration and optimization of APIs to create innovative therapies that address unmet medical needs.

Understanding the Complex World of Compounding Pharmacy Services

Compounding pharmacies provide a vital service by tailoring medications to fulfill individual patient needs. Nevertheless, navigating the world of compounding pharmacy services can be complex.

Patients should meticulously research and select a reliable compounding pharmacy that is registered and complies to strict quality standards. It's essential to consult your doctor about whether a compounded medication is indicated for your illness.

Additionally, understanding the procedure involved in compounding, including the elements used and potential pros, is essential for making informed decisions.
